Key Elements of Ethnic Decor
- Colors: Ethnic decor often features vibrant and bold colors such as reds, blues, oranges, and yellows. These colors can be incorporated through textiles, wall art, and accessories to create a lively and inviting space.
- Patterns: Geometric patterns, intricate designs, and traditional motifs are hallmark features of ethnic decor. From intricate Moroccan tiles to bold African prints, incorporating these patterns can add visual interest and depth to your home.
- Textures: Natural materials like wood, rattan, jute, and clay are commonly used in ethnic decor. These textures add a tactile element to your space and create a sense of warmth and coziness.
- Handcrafted Pieces: Handmade items such as pottery, baskets, textiles, and ceramics bring a sense of authenticity and uniqueness to your decor. They tell a story of skilled craftsmanship and cultural heritage.
How to Incorporate Ethnic Decor
There are various ways to incorporate ethnic decor into your home:
- Choose statement pieces such as a handwoven rug from Turkey or a vibrant tapestry from India to serve as focal points in your room.
- Display a collection of global artifacts like masks, sculptures, or textiles on a gallery wall to showcase your travels and appreciation for different cultures.
- Integrate ethnic elements into your existing decor through throw pillows, blankets, and ceramics that reflect the colors and patterns of a specific culture.
